Form 4: Rush Street Interactive Director Leslie Bluhm Awarded Restricted Stock Units

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4 Filing


Director Leslie Bluhm received 24,415 restricted stock units in Rush Street Interactive, Inc.

Summary

  • Leslie N. Bluhm, a director of Rush Street Interactive, Inc., was awarded 24,415 restricted stock units (RSUs) on March 15, 2024.
  • The RSUs were granted under the company's 2020 Omnibus Equity Incentive Plan.
  • These RSUs will vest at the company's next annual meeting of stockholders in 2025.
  • Following the transaction, Bluhm directly owns 100,671 shares of Class A Common Stock.
